Iran war’s skyrocketing diesel prices hit American farmers already facing historic drought
did:plc:y5dd75sd5l5hmerwpuiwdkol
May 4, 2026
Diesel prices have increased by about 48% since the start of the war — a backbreaker for U.S. farmers facing the most widespread spring drought on record.
